Congenital Protein C Deficiency Treatment Market Analysis and Size

The congenital protein C deficiency treatment market is expected to witness significant growth during the forecast period. People with milder protein C deficiency may not have symptoms (asymptomatic) until they reach adulthood. Others may remain asymptomatic. People suffering from protein C deficiency are at higher risk of developing a condition called Warfarin-induced skin necrosis. The occurrence of the milder form is around 1 in 200-500 people in the general population.

Data Bridge Market Research analyses a growth rate in the congenital protein C deficiency treatment market in the forecast period 2023-2030. The expected CAGR of congenital protein C deficiency treatment market is tend to be around 7% in the mentioned forecast period. The market was valued at USD 450 million in 2022, and it would grow upto USD 773.18 million by 2030. Market Definition

Protein C deficiency is a rare type of genetic condition that is characterized by protein C deficiency, which is a naturally occurring anticoagulant. There is a mild process in which the person affected is at risk of developing blood clots, particularly a type of blood clot called deep vein thrombosis. This clot generally forms in the legs. This is a severe form present at birth (congenital) and can cause widespread small clots in the body and life-threatening complications in infancy.

  • Increasing Demand of genetic Testing

There are varied diagnostic tests that are helping in increasing the market growth. Healthcare professionals will run blood tests that will determine the activity of protein C in the blood. Besides this, molecular genetic testing can be performed as it can confirm a diagnosis of protein C deficiency, but generally is not crucial. Molecular genetic testing can detect alterations (mutations) in the PROC gene known to cause this disorder.
